is a village at the base of the Beara Peninsula of in southwest Ireland. It's in an inlet of Bantry Bay, and became a tourist resort in the late 19th century.

is a village in in southwest Ireland. It's at the head of Bay: north of the bay is Iveragh Peninsula, and its coast road is the popular Ring of Kerry tourist route.
